A newly-unsealed federal indictment accuses former U.S. president Donald Trump of conspiring with six close allies to try and overturn his 2020 election loss to President Joe Biden and unlawfully block the transfer of power, which culminated in the deadly Jan. 6, 2021, attack by Trump’s supporters on the U.S. Capitol.

Trump was charged with four criminal counts, including conspiracy to defraud the United States, attempting to obstruct an official proceeding, and conspiracy to “injure, oppress, threaten, and intimidate” those exercising the right to vote “and to have one’s vote counted,” according to the document. The last statute is part of the Civil Rights Act.

U.S. Department of Justice special counsel Jack Smith delivered a statement on Tuesday, providing details on Trump's latest indictment for his efforts to overturn the 2020 election results.

"The attack on our nation's Capitol on January 6, 2021 was an unprecedented assault on the seat of American democracy," Smith said.
